Jogging around North Chevy Chase offers access to a network of green spaces and natural parks, providing diverse landscapes for runners. The region is characterized by its proximity to the extensive Rock Creek Park trail system, featuring woodlands, varied terrain, and both paved and unpaved paths. Local parks and nature sanctuaries contribute to a pleasant natural ambiance, making it suitable for a range of running experiences.

Meadowbrook Stables is a peaceful equestrian escape nestled in Rock Creek Park, Meadowbrook Stables offers lessons, trail rides, and the chance to watch riders in training. Even if you're not riding, it’s a scenic detour on a cycling or walking route, with horses grazing near the path and the quiet rustle of the woods make this spot feel a world away from DC. Best visited in the early morning or late afternoon for golden light and fewer crowds.

Established in 1934, Meadowbrook Stables is a historic horseback riding school located along the Rock Creek Trail. Visitors are welcome to enjoy the grounds during summer hours, except for when the stables are closed on Sundays. For safety, only riders and staff may access the barn. Guests can greet horses in the outdoor stalls and enjoy the picnic area.

This popular 7-mile, multi-use trail, travels between Bethesda, Maryland and Georgetown in Washington D.C. It is a very popular path for walkers, runners, and cyclists so be courteous to your fellow trail users. Portions of it pass by Little Falls Stream and the Chesapeake & Ohio Canal so you can find some lovely waterfront views.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available in and around North Chevy Chase?

North Chevy Chase offers a wide variety of running experiences, with over 150 routes available. These range from easy neighborhood paths to more challenging trails within extensive natural parks.

What kind of terrain can I expect on jogging routes near North Chevy Chase?

Jogging routes in North Chevy Chase feature a diverse mix of terrain. You'll find accessible neighborhood paths, as well as extensive natural parks like Rock Creek Park, which offers both paved and unpaved trails. Expect varied landscapes, from serene woodlands to more challenging, hilly sections, providing options for all preferences.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ly jogging routes in North Chevy Chase?

Yes, North Chevy Chase provides options for all fitness levels. For an easy and accessible jog, consider the paths within North Chevy Chase Local Park, which offers a pleasant, shaded route. Additionally, some sections of the Rock Creek Trail are relatively flat and paved, suitable for beginners.

Can I bring my dog on the running trails in North Chevy Chase?

Many of the natural parks and trails in the North Chevy Chase area, including sections of Rock Creek Park, are dog-friendly. However, it's always best to check specific park regulations regarding leash requirements and restricted areas before heading out with your canine companion.

Are there any circular running routes available in the area?

Yes, many routes in and around North Chevy Chase are designed as loops, offering convenient circular runs. For example, the Stoney Creek Pond loop from Bethesda is a popular moderate option, and within Rock Creek Park, you can find numerous loop configurations like the Beach Drive, Rock Creek Park loop from Chevy Chase Section Five.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while jogging in North Chevy Chase?

The jogging routes in North Chevy Chase offer access to several natural and historical landmarks. You can explore the diverse habitats of Woodend Nature Sanctuary, or run alongside Rock Creek itself. Within the broader Rock Creek Park system, you might encounter features like the historic Boulder Bridge or the tranquil Rock Creek. The Peirce Mill is another notable point of interest.

What is the best time of year to go jogging in North Chevy Chase?

North Chevy Chase offers excellent jogging conditions throughout much of the year. Spring and fall provide pleasant temperatures and beautiful foliage. Summer runs are enjoyable, especially on shaded trails, though it's best to go in the mornings or evenings. Even in winter, many trails remain accessible, offering a peaceful, crisp running experience.

Are there any family-friendly running options?

Yes, North Chevy Chase has several family-friendly running options. Local parks like North Chevy Chase Local Park offer easy, short loops perfect for families with younger children. The paved sections of the Rock Creek Trail also provide a safe and enjoyable environment for family runs.

How does jogging in North Chevy Chase compare to Rock Creek Park?

Jogging in North Chevy Chase is largely defined by its exceptional access to the vast Rock Creek Park system. While North Chevy Chase itself offers local green spaces like North Chevy Chase Local Park, the region's primary appeal for runners is its gateway to Rock Creek Park's extensive network of trails. This means you get the best of both worlds: convenient neighborhood runs and immersive experiences within the larger natural oasis of Rock Creek Park.
